Review 19- Bluebell Cottage

When I bought this book, I have to admit I kinda bought it out of pity. The author was there and I picked it up to read the back out of interest, and we talked a bit and it seemed like no one had bought one since she'd been there. So I got it signed and bought it. And after reading it, I have a few problems with it.

My main problem is the audience it's aimed at. It's in the 9-12 years old section. The main character is mid 30s, so I think it's hard to connect with her because of the age. Near the start there's a talk about her dead daughter, and near the end there's quite a strong conversation about relationship and such. It's not just a simple fairy war like I thought it would be, and it focused a lot more on the relationship between two characters which brings me onto my second main problem.

The author continuously talks about Twilight, for a few pages. It really annoyed me. Then you continue with it and you notice some similarities between the series and this book. Firstly, the two guys after her (I know that love triangles are common, but there's just this thing where there's the friend and then there's the incredibly hot guy who gives the friend no chance of getting the girl), second she actually leaves to protect him, which is role reversal from Twilight, but you get my drift. Oh, and the main character? Complete klutz. It was things like that which annoyed me, because obviously when she tells you about Twilight once or twice you start to see the similarities because there's this idea 'oh this is a good book that I love so I'm going to talk about it in my book' you know? I wanted to hear the author's voice, but I only got her admiration for that series.

I'm not going to go into anything else because I don't want to remember it because I'll just moan about it. To be honest the characters weren't too bad, they just seemed really similar to obvious characters.

Overall Rating- 3.5 out of 10 (that's being generous)
Would I read anything else by this author- No, definitely not.
Anything else- Usually I don't do this, but if you're thinking about reading this, just don't, I'm sorry it's not great.
